Lincoln Woman’s Club hosts
domestic violence awareness expo
[September 23, 2025]
In recognition of the General
Federation of Women’s Club’s (GFWC) International Day of Service,
Lincoln Woman’s Club will be hosting a Domestic Violence Awareness
Expo on Saturday, September 27th from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. at the
Lincoln Woman’s Club Building, 230 N. McLean Street, Lincoln,
Illinois. Everyone is invited to attend.
The purpose of this expo is to provide information on the problem of
domestic violence in the world, our country and our community and to
showcase those organizations that exist to help those in domestic
violence situations in our area. Organizations will be represented
to provide information regarding services available and local
resources.
Visitors are welcome to come and learn about these organizations.
The club will also be accepting donations of old cell phones, which
will be sent to the National Coalition Against Domestic Violence
where they turn them into donations to support their cause.
Donations of gently used or new stuffed animals will also be
accepted. These will be donated to Sojourn Shelter and Services
Center in Springfield, which services Logan County.
The General Federation of Women’s Clubs (GFWC,) with which the
Lincoln Woman’s Club is affiliated, is united in its dedication to
volunteer community service. For the third consecutive year, the
2025 GFWC International Day of Service (GFWC IDS), formerly the GFWC
National Day of Service, is scheduled on Saturday, September 27, to
help end domestic and sexual violence across the United States and
internationally.

According to the
World Health Organization, it is estimated that between 736
million to 862 million women, aged 15 years or older, have
experienced domestic and/or sexual violence. Within the United
States, based on research conducted by the Centers for Disease
Control and Prevention, more than 16 million people are affected
every year. According to the Lincoln Police, 204 cases of
domestic violence were reported from January 1 to September 1,
2025, in Lincoln, Illinois.
GFWC Lincoln Woman’s Club was organized in July of 1896 in
Lincoln, Illinois. Their mission is “to improve and enhance the
lives of others through volunteer service.”
